Subject: Quickstore 4.2 — bloom filter now fronts the KV layer

Plugin authors: starting with this release, Quickstore places a bloom filter ahead of the key-value store. Negative lookups return faster; false positives fall through safely. No API changes are required on your side. Verify your plugin against the staging build referenced below.

session token of fahif-tadup = htk3_9c7

Key Ceremony Checklist — Item 12 (for weekly eng sync). Status: the metrics-aggregation sidecar (Grelling) now signs its batch uploads, so its key must be enrolled during Thursday's ceremony. Prereqs done: sidecar pinned to v2.4, aggregation window set to 30s, dashboards confirmed reading from the new endpoint. Remaining: two keyholders present, ceremony laptop offline, HSM checked out of the Dunmoor cabinet. Once both keyholders verify the fingerprint on screen, the enrollment vault is opened by entering the recovery passphrase below.

recovery phrase for fajep-yaweg: gilath-sorox-wenius-rusdor-keliel-zorius

Subject: Handover — ProfileVault sharding rollout

Hi Doran,

Handing over mid-migration: shards 1–4 of ProfileVault are live on the new ring, shards 5–8 still replicate from the legacy store. Access controls on the new shards mirror the old ACL set; I verified checksums on all migrated partitions this morning. Audit logs are retained in the usual vault. If anything in the access model looks off during review, contact the sharding lead directly.

escalation mailbox, bafog-fafog: ulador@paliqlabs.internal

## Environments: Cronfall migration

Quick orientation for plugin authors: we're moving all the old cron jobs into the Cronfall workflow engine, one environment at a time. Dev is fully migrated, staging is about halfway, and prod still runs the legacy crontab — so don't assume your plugin's schedule hooks fire the same way everywhere yet. Test against staging first; it's the closest to where prod will land. Each environment reads its settings at boot, and staging currently runs with the following.

settings of yaguf-fajof:
[druvan]
host = druvan.plorvatech.example
user = druvan_svc
database = druvan_prod